The Gettysburg Address: The Complete Teaching Guide

On November 19, 1863 President Abraham Lincoln delivered what is arguably the most famous 272 words in the English language - The Gettysburg Address. In 2013, the United States will celebrate the 150th anniversery of that pivotal speech. With this convenient guide, you can energize your middle school or high school social studies curriculum with dynamic "hands-on, minds-on" projects and activities for The Gettysburg Address. You can help your students understand and appreciate this timeless document with a wide range of interactive and "classroom-tested" experiences appropriate for any program and any classroom. Geared towards national social studies standards (e.g. Time, Continuity, and Change) this teacher resource is a perfect addition to any curriculum.
